摘要

A non-invasive arteriovenous pressure measuring device capable of measuring an arteriovenous pressure noninvasively and accurately and an arteriovenous pressure measuring method using the measuring device are provided. A non-invasive arteriovenous pressure measuring device, a probe (20) that irradiates ultrasonic waves toward blood vessels in the skin, and a pressing unit that is sandwiched between the skin and the probe (20) and presses the skin (10) and a pressure sensor (33) for detecting a pressing force on the skin in the pressing portion (10), the pressing portion (10) includes water (36) that transmits ultrasonic waves, water ( 36) and a balloon (31) formed of a flexible material that transmits ultrasonic waves, and presses the skin on the outer surface of the balloon (31).
